The Director, Property Accounting will lead the end-to-end property accounting function across Taylor’s 3 rd party management portfolio. This hands-on role is responsible for ensuring accurate and timely financial reporting, maintaining strong accounting practices and controls, and delivering a high level of service to internal and external stakeholders.
This full-time hybrid role is based out of our modern, eco-friendly office in Markham, Ontario located near Hwy 7 & 404.
As a key business partner to Property Management, and Finance leadership, the Director will provide insight, guidance, and financial information that supports strong decision-making. The Director will be primarily responsible for the delivery of monthly, quarterly and annual reporting to the various ownership groups on behalf of the finance team – whether that be electronic delivery, virtual or in-person presentations. The role also will focus on strengthening accounting processes, enhancing reporting practices, and building a high-performing team aligned with Taylor+ growth objectives.
